Could somebody give me an example of the oil pressure I should have reading. I recently bought a 98 Blazer with the 4.3 in it. It has a slight knock to the motor. The motor has a 177,000 miles on it and still runs like a champ. I am trying to avoid the repair as long as possible. This unit is unbelievably clean. I changed the oil in the unit and went to a 10w 30 synthetic with a bottle of Prolong and the pressure dropped slightly. I was skeptical on the Prolong product in the first place. Does anybody have any helpful advice? Please e-mail me, or respond to this if you get a chance. Thanks for any and all advice.

Re: Oil Pressure
well Blazers are made to operate with 5w 30 not 10. as to what your pressure is gonna be at it will vary my pressure when driving is ususally around 40 PSI and down near 10 when idling once it is warm.

Opinion:
Prolong: According to Dupont teflon is not designed to be in an internal combustion engine. Prolong is snake oil that could plug up oil galleys and create dry spots. 10W-30 wrong oil...put 5W-30 in that's what the manufacturer recommends. Why ? Startup where most wear occurs, will take longer to circulate. suggestion: 1. Take filter off, and install a cheap filter. 2. pour 1 can of gunk engine flush, or sea-foam in crankcase. 3. start car and let IDLE for 30 minutes. Don't drive, run just let it idle. 4. warm engine, drain oil as usual.... 5. Do you normal oil change, you can put 5W-30 dino or synthetic oil. If you use dino oil, I'd use Castrol GTX. Filters: Make sure you use a decent filter...not Fram ...suggest AC-Delco And you will be good to go..... Don't be fooled by snake oils, the key to your engine, as I have 158000 on mine, is keep it clean for oil to circulate....clean clean clean.... snake oils just mask those beater engines and quite some of the tappet noise by gumming them up....it works ......for a while.... stay on top of you oil changes, whether you use synth, or dino oil ....don't neglect...
